Unlocking the Secrets to BA Reward Seats: Book Your Luxury Travel Adventures

Relaxing on a tropical beach hammock at sunset, perfect for British Airways reward flights.

Exploring the Allure of British Airways Reward Seats

British Airways (BA) reward seats have become a coveted asset for both frequent travelers and casual flyers alike. With an impressive roster of over 15 million members in its loyalty program, BA has successfully tapped into the demand for premium travel by making its Avios points irresistible. But what exactly fuels this frenzy for BA reward flights? Let’s dive into the specifics, focusing on the most sought-after routes and exclusive booking tips that can help you unlock these luxurious travel experiences.

Understanding Premium Cabin Redemptions

One of the primary reasons BA rewards flights are so attractive is the opportunity for high-value premium cabin redemptions. Business and First Class seats can often cost thousands of dollars, making Avios a game-changer for those hoping to travel in style without breaking the bank. The chance to experience exceptional comfort and services aboard Club World or First Class makes the effort worthwhile, especially when these seats offer greater value compared to cash purchases.

Why Are BA Reward Flights So Popular?

Several factors contribute to the popularity of BA reward flights:

  • Guaranteed Availability: BA guarantees a minimum of 12 to 14 reward seats per flight, with allocations across all cabin classes. This assurance makes it easier for Avios collectors to plan journeys well in advance, with reservation opportunities available up to 355 days prior to departure.
  • Flexible Pricing with Reward Flight Saver: BA's Reward Flight Saver pricing model caps taxes and surcharges, allowing travelers to predict costs more effectively. This model transforms complex pricing structures into straightforward amounts, ensuring that travelers are not caught off guard during their planning.
  • Extensive Earning Opportunities: The ability to earn Avios through various channels—from credit cards to hotel partnerships—amplifies the appeal. With the option to convert everyday purchases, luxurious travels suddenly become much more accessible.

The Competition for Coveted Routes

For many Avios collectors, popular long-haul routes are the holy grail of reward flights. Destinations such as New York, Hong Kong, and Sydney frequently see intense competition for seats due to their commercial appeal. As data shows that many potential travelers monitor availability with tools and alerts, the sales of these seats can close rapidly, requiring vigilance from interested bookers.

Top Routes for Reward Travel

While the full list encapsulates various global destinations, the most popular routes typically include:

  • London (LHR) to New York (JFK) – A staple for both business and leisure travelers seeking luxury travel experiences.
  • London (LHR) to Dubai (DXB) – A prime route given the growing interest in Middle Eastern tourism.
  • London (LHR) to Los Angeles (LAX) – The gateway to sunny California, capturing the interest of affluent travelers.

Travel Strategies for Securing Reward Seats

Navigating the world of Avios bookings can be complex, but several strategies can improve your chances:

  • Be Flexible: Flight availability can vary remarkably based on demand. Being open to travel dates and routes increases your chances of securing that elusive seat.
  • Set Alerts: Utilize apps and websites that notify you when reward seats become available. Regular checks on availability during peak periods can lead to the discovery of unexpected openings.
  • Book in Advance: Since BA allows bookings up to 355 days out, taking advantage of this window enables access to the best selection of seats.

Unleashing the Essence of Longevity and Travel in Blue Zones

Update Discovering the Secrets of Longevity in Blue ZonesHow often do we think about the pursuit of longevity? For affluent travelers yearning for a blend of adventure, culture, and wellness, the concept of "Blue Zones" provides a captivating guide to living well and aging gracefully. These uniquely identified regions of the world boast not only stunning landscapes but also a rich tapestry of lifestyles that contribute to the extraordinary longevity of their inhabitants.What Are Blue Zones?First introduced by National Geographic fellow Dan Buettner, Blue Zones are regions identified by their remarkable populations who live into their 90s and beyond, often free from chronic diseases. These regions—Okinawa in Japan, Sardinia in Italy, the Nicoya Peninsula in Costa Rica, Ikaria in Greece, and Loma Linda in California—provide revealing insights into the habits that support long, healthy lives.Healthy Lifestyle Traits of Blue ZonesTraveling to these regions not only exposes you to breathtaking natural beauty but also immerses you in their day-to-day practices, which can be transformative for your own life. From their plant-dominant diets to their strong social connections, let's take a closer look at some distinctive characteristics that promote longevity:Nutrient-Dense Diets: The predominant diets in Blue Zones are rich in whole, plant-based foods, which include vegetables, legumes, and whole grains. Residents consume meat sparingly, typically only a few times a month, favoring meals that enhance vitality rather than merely fill the stomach.Natural Movement: Instead of structured exercise regimes, individuals in Blue Zones engage in daily physical activities that are integrated into their lifestyles—gardening, walking, and manual tasks keep them active without the strain of a gym.Strong Community Ties: Emotional well-being plays a crucial role in longevity. The close-knit relationships and communal bonds found in these areas foster a sense of belonging, reduce stress, and enhance life satisfaction.Purpose-Driven Living: A deep sense of purpose or "plan de vida" is crucial for the residents of these areas. This element not only fosters daily motivation but is also associated with reduced mortality rates.Mindful Eating Practices: The Okinawans, for example, practice "hara hachi bu," which encourages individuals to stop eating when they feel 80% full, a habit believed to contribute to their long and healthy lives.Traveling to Blue Zones: A Personal JourneyAs an affluent traveler, experiencing Blue Zones goes beyond mere tourism; it’s about embracing their philosophies and lifestyle to foster long-term wellness. Consider embarking on a trip to these unique locales—not merely to witness their charm but to glean insights on how you can integrate their practices into your own life.This is not just about the exotic dishes or the mesmerizing landscapes; it’s an invitation to reflect on your own lifestyle. Start by planning your visit around local festivals, cooking classes, and communal meals that allow you to interact closely with the residents and their traditions.Emotional and Human Connection: Sharing ExperiencesThe rich stories and shared experiences within the communities of Blue Zones add depth to your travel. Engage in local festivities like Ikaria’s panigyria (community celebrations filled with music and dance) or participate in outdoor meals in Sardinia’s vibrant piazzas, creating bonds that transcend cultural barriers.By stepping outside of your comfort zone and sharing meals with locals, you will not only savor the fresh flavors of their diets but also foster emotional connections that resonate with the spirit of the region.Bringing the Lessons HomeWhat can you take from this? The principles that define Blue Zones — healthy eating, active living, strong social ties, and a sense of purpose — can be adapted into your day-to-day life, regardless of where you reside. These insights encourage us to slow down, value community, and prioritize our mental health.Your Adventure AwaitsFor travelers intent on not just seeing but feeling, Blue Zones offer transformative experiences that extend beyond their borders. As you embark on your next luxury travel adventure, remember that it’s not merely about the destination; it’s about absorbing a lifestyle that celebrates health, community, and happiness. Explore Unique Airbnbs Across Portugal: From Beachfront Villas to City Gems

Update Discover the Allure of Airbnb Stays Across Portugal Portugal is a remarkable tapestry of experiences, stretching from its coastline dotted with golden sands to the terraced vineyards of the Douro Valley. As more travelers look to immerse themselves in local culture, Airbnb emerges not just as an accommodation option but as a means to dive deep into the heart of Portuguese life. From urban escapes in bustling cities like Lisbon and Porto to tranquil getaways in quaint villages, the variety of Airbnbs offers something for everyone. Why Choose Airbnb for Your Portuguese Retreat? Opting for an Airbnb allows travelers to steep themselves in authenticity. Unlike standard hotels, many Airbnb hosts provide personal touches and insights into their locales, sharing hidden gems that tourist guides might overlook. This level of hospitality can often be attributed to the warmth inherent in Portuguese culture, where locals take pride in their heritage and are eager to share it with visitors. Additionally, Airbnb's diverse range of properties—from historic homes to modern villas—ensures that there's a perfect match for every type of traveler. Highlights of Airbnbs in Coastal Regions The allure of Portugal's coastline is undeniable. Stunning beachside homes, such as those in the Algarve, provide immediate access to some of the most beautiful beaches in Europe. For example, a beachside home in Faro offers not only proximity to pristine sands but also amenities like a sun-drenched terrace and proximity to local surf schools. There’s a balance between relaxation and adventure as guests can enjoy both sun-soaked afternoons and thrilling watersports within footsteps of their accommodations. Cultural and Historical Retreats For travelers seeking a cultural experience, properties located in historic centers, such as the award-winning apartments in Lisbon's Baixa district, allow guests to engage with the vibrant history of the area. These homes often boast intricate designs and historical significance, evoking the architectural elegance of past eras while providing modern comforts. Staying in such locales not only enhances the travel experience but also deepens one’s appreciation for Portugal's rich history and culture. Unique Experiences in the Douro Valley Perhaps no region in Portugal showcases the country’s cultural and natural beauty like the Douro Valley. Here, visitors can reside in family-owned villas that celebrate Portugal’s viticultural heritage. A notable example is a charming villa that offers breathtaking views of terraced vineyards, where guests can savor local wines while soaking in the idyllic landscape. The immersive experience of staying in a region specializing in wine production provides a delightful backdrop for relaxation and exploration. Airbnb’s Role in Supporting Local Economies Choosing Airbnb contributes not only to your personal travel agenda, but it also helps bolster local economies. Many hosts use the income generated from rentals to maintain their homes, invest in their communities, or fund local initiatives. This connection fosters a cycle of financial support that enhances the livelihood of both hosts and travelers alike. Making the Most of Your Airbnb Stay While booking an Airbnb stay, consider the amenities and location that will best serve your travel needs. Utilize filters to narrow down choices based on your group size, budget, and desired experiences. Moreover, interact with your host to get the most out of your stay—local recommendations often reveal the best dining spots, entertainment, and off-the-beaten-path attractions. With the right planning, your Airbnb can serve not just as a place to sleep, but as a launchpad for vibrant adventures throughout Portugal. Portugal’s scenic variety, cultural richness, and hospitable locals make it a top choice for travelers looking for unique stays. So whether it's a chic studio in the heart of Porto, a tranquil retreat in the Douro Valley, or a charming village home, the offerings available through Airbnb create a tailor-made Portuguese experience unlike any other.

Unveiling New Zealand's Luxury Glamping Destinations for Affluent Travelers

Update Discovering New Zealand's Hidden Luxuries New Zealand continues to capture the imagination of affluent travelers seeking luxury travel experiences that go beyond the ordinary. With its stunning landscapes, rich indigenous culture, and commitment to sustainability, the country's glamping scene has found its niche, attracting those who crave indulgent experiences in nature's embrace. These exclusive stays redefine comfort while allowing guests to immerse themselves in the wild, proving that luxury doesn't always mean a stuffy hotel room. Heartwood Hollow: A Glamping Gem in Bay of Plenty Heartwood Hollow stands out as a symphony of nature and luxury—a magical earth house nestled within old native bush. Just twenty minutes away from the city of Tauranga, this destination leaves visitors spellbound as they traverse a winding cobblestone path leading to an arched timber entrance. Inside, guests find a king-size bed draped in sumptuous linens, artisanal kitchen designs from recycled Totara, and a spacious ensuite designed thoughtfully so every inch whispers luxury. Imagine curling up next to a hissing wood fire stove, with amber light spill showing the craftsmanship put into this hobbit-like dream. Adjacent, two outdoor bathtubs offer a perfect stargazing spot, creating an intimate atmosphere perfect for romantic getaways or exclusive luxury honeymoons. Wild Canvas: Experience Luxury Under the Stars Located in the breathtaking Te Kūiti region, Wild Canvas brings glamping to an extravagant level. The Pōhutukawa tent offers an incredible 360-degree view for its guests. Picture yourself soaking in a heated spa while the sun sets behind rolling hills, turning the sky into a painter's palette of colors. Combining luxury furnishings with nature, this family-friendly space provides a unique atmosphere ideal for luxury family travel or group vacations where personalized travel planning can yield unforgettable memories. Braided Point: Canterbury’s Off-the-Beaten-Path Delight For those who prefer seclusion paired with luxury, Braided Point delivers. Situated on a high-country cattle station just a stone's throw from Christchurch, this high-end pod experience is a canvas of ever-changing scenery. With the Rakaia River weaving seamlessly through the landscape, guests witness nature's artistry unfold before their eyes. The two interconnected luxury pods are designed for indoor-outdoor living, ensuring that while you enjoy the lavish comforts, you're also immersed in the surrounding beauty—perfect for those adventurous spirits who desire exclusive global travel updates that cater to their high standards. SkyScape: A Stargazer's Paradise in Twizel SkyScape, located just south of Twizel on the Omahau Hill Station, is perfect for those yearning for a celestial connection. The architecturally designed pods offer trails of glass that ensure an uninterrupted view of the night sky, making it perfect for vacationing couples. The experience is enhanced by the local community, which is dedicated to preserving the environmental integrity of this pristine landscape, truly embodying wellness travel experiences that leave a positive impact. Immersing Yourself in Nature and Luxury Luxury and nature have long been at odds, but New Zealand proves that they can coexist magnificently. Experiences like glamping blend adventure with high-end amenities, allowing for a more intimate connection with the wilderness while still enjoying the pampering that comes with bespoke travel packages. Whether it's family luxury travel, luxury group travel, or solo wellness retreats, the options are limitless. The country invites travelers to discover its hidden luxuries, fueling aspirations for those seeking ultra-luxury travel trends and ultimate relaxation away from the bustle of city life.
